【netframework3.5是什么】.NET Framework 3.5 是微软推出的一个重要的软件开发平台,主要用于构建和运行 Windows 应用程序。它是 .NET Framework 3.0 的升级版,在功能、性能和兼容性方面都有所增强。它支持多种编程语言,如 C、VB.NET 等,并提供了丰富的类库和工具,方便开发者快速开发应用程序。
以下是关于 .NET Framework 3.5 的简要总结:
一、基本介绍
| 项目 | 内容 |
| 名称 | .NET Framework 3.5 |
| 开发商 | 微软(Microsoft) |
| 发布时间 | 2007年11月 |
| 主要用途 | 构建和运行 Windows 应用程序、Web 应用、服务等 |
| 支持语言 | C, VB.NET, F, J 等 |
| 依赖环境 | Windows 操作系统(Windows XP SP2 及以上版本) |
二、主要特性
| 特性 | 说明 |
| WPF(Windows Presentation Foundation) | 提供了更强大的图形界面开发能力 |
| WCF(Windows Communication Foundation) | 实现了跨平台、跨语言的通信服务 |
| WF(Windows Workflow Foundation) | 支持工作流的定义与执行 |
| LINQ(Language Integrated Query) | 在 C 和 VB.NET 中直接使用 SQL 风格的查询 |
| ASP.NET 3.5 | 增强了 Web 开发功能,支持 AJAX 等新技术 |
三、应用场景
| 应用场景 | 说明 |
| 桌面应用开发 | 使用 WPF 或 WinForms 进行界面设计 |
| Web 应用开发 | 利用 ASP.NET 构建动态网站 |
| 企业级应用 | 通过 WCF 和 WF 构建分布式系统 |
| 数据访问 | 使用 LINQ 或 ADO.NET 进行数据库操作 |
四、兼容性与限制
| 项目 | 内容 |
| 兼容系统 | Windows XP SP2、Windows Server 2003、Windows Vista、Windows 7 等 |
| 不支持系统 | Windows 8 及以后版本需使用更新的 .NET 版本(如 .NET 4.x) |
| 升级建议 | 若需在较新系统上开发,建议使用 .NET Framework 4.x 或 .NET Core |
五、总结
.NET Framework 3.5 是一个功能强大且广泛使用的开发平台,尤其在早期的 Windows 应用开发中起到了重要作用。虽然现在已有更新的版本,但在一些遗留系统或特定项目中仍然有其价值。对于开发者来说,了解其特点和适用范围有助于更好地进行技术选型和系统维护。


